Corporate Worship

 We look forward to gathering weekly as a local body of believers each Sunday morning at 10:15 AM. Our services consist of several different worship elements. We will sing biblically based, Christ-centered songs, hear dynamic expositional preaching of the Word, read aloud and memorize scripture as a congregation, give tithes and offerings with joyful hearts to the Lord, pray prayers of adoration, confession, thanksgiving, and supplication, and observe the ordinances of baptism and the Lord’s Supper. We hope our services first and foremost glorify God and that they are also edifying and sanctifying for our body to live Gospel-minded lives in a dark world.

CONGREGATIONAL SINGING

Each Sunday you will find us singing songs that are rich in doctrine and played with excellence. We sing hymns that have been passed down us by faithful Christians before us, as well as songs that have been recently written. Because we are a diverse congregation, we lovingly put aside personal preferences for a style of worship that a range of people can enjoy.

Expository Preaching 

We believe that the Bible is God's inspired Word without any mixture of error. We preach through books of the Bible so that we can understand all that God has said to us in context. We strive to make the main point of the Bible passage the main point of our sermons and we always point to Jesus.

Scripture Reading

In 1 Timothy 4:13, the apostle Paul instructed local churches to "give attention to the public reading of Scripture." Each week the Scripture text for the sermon will be read aloud. The congregation will also recite the Scripture memory verse of the month together as an act of worship and as an aid to memorization.

Baptism

Baptism happens after someone is born again as they publicly profess their faith in Christ alone for salvation from sin. It symbolizes their dying to sin and rising to new life in Christ. It is a visual depiction of the gospel for all to see! 

The Lord's Supper

The Lord's Supper commemorates the broken body of Jesus and His shed blood for our sins. We invite you to participate with us if you have been born again and have received believer's baptism by immersion. We observe Baptism and the Lord's Supper as a church-wide celebration, with our English and Spanish services meeting together as one family.
